Taxation Wages Near Meadville

OccupationMedian Annual Wage (Pennsylvania, statewide)
Accountant and Auditor$79,000
Tax Preparer$61,270
Tax Examiner and Collector$56,870

Source: BLS, May 2025 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.

How do I verify a program is accredited?

Confirm institutional accreditation via the U.S. Department of Education database (U.S. Dept. of Education database), and check for any program-specific accreditation listed by the school.
